Turn on your captions and then go to 49:00 mark on episode 6. He clearly says, "Wait, wait...Daphne..." He's pretty much begging her to stop. She doesn't. It's rape.

In the book, in Chapter 18, he's drunk and asleep. She climbs on top. Here are bits from that scene in the book:

"He was in her control, she realized. He was asleep, and probably still more more than a little bit drunk, and she could do whatever she wanted with him. She could have whatever she wanted."

"Daphne had aroused him in sleep, taken advantage of him while he was slightly intoxicated, and held him to her while he poured his seed into her. His eyes widened and fixed on hers. 'How could you?' he whispered. "

"She wasn't ashamed of her actions. She supposed she should be, but she wasn't."
